HIIT Incline Walking Techniques for Maximum Calorie Burn
Incorporating high-intensity interval training into your treadmill routine can significantly enhance calorie burn. By strategically adjusting the incline and alternating between intense bursts of effort and recovery periods, you can optimize your workout. This section will explore effective techniques for HIIT incline walking to help you achieve your fitness goals.
Executing a successful HIIT incline walking routine involves specific intervals and incline adjustments. Follow this structured approach for optimal results.
-
Warm-Up: Walk at a flat incline for 5-10 minutes.
-
High-Intensity Interval: Increase the incline to 8-12% and walk briskly for 30 seconds.
-
Recovery Interval: Lower the incline to 1-2% and walk at a moderate pace for 1-2 minutes.
-
Repeat: Alternate between high-intensity and recovery intervals for 20-30 minutes.
-
Cool Down: Walk at a flat incline for 5-10 minutes.
HIIT Treadmill Walking Interval Plan
Incorporating a HIIT treadmill walking interval plan can significantly enhance calorie burning during your workouts. This strategy combines high-intensity bursts with recovery periods, making it an efficient way to maximize your time on the treadmill. By adjusting the incline and pace, you can elevate your heart rate and boost your overall fitness results.
| Interval Type | Duration | Incline Level |
|---|---|---|
| Warm-Up | 5-10 minutes | 0% |
| High-Intensity | 30 seconds | 10% |
| Recovery | 1 minute | 2% |
| Repeat Intervals | 20-30 minutes | Varies |
| Cool Down | 5-10 minutes | 0% |

Common Mistakes to Avoid
When utilizing a treadmill for high-intensity interval training, it’s crucial to be aware of common pitfalls that can hinder your calorie-burning potential. Avoiding these mistakes can enhance your workout efficiency and help you achieve better results. Understanding what to watch out for will ensure you maximize the benefits of your incline walking strategy.
Avoiding common pitfalls during your HIIT incline walking sessions can improve results. Awareness of these mistakes helps you stay on track.
-
Skipping Warm-Up: Neglecting this can lead to injuries.
-
Incorrect Incline Settings: Too steep can cause strain; too flat may not yield benefits.
-
Poor Form: Slouching or leaning forward reduces effectiveness and increases injury risk.
-
Inconsistent Intervals: Sticking to the timing is crucial for maximizing benefits.
